Absolutly gay to put a timing belt on. You can do it while engine staying in car by removing whell well on left side. But even then you gotta remove some pullys and its still hard to get it "just right" the belt will stretch a little after you get it lined up. So you might think you have it right the first time. Then crank it once and it will be a tooth off. Ive helped do it with friends cars about 5 times now.
